Queen Elizabeth II: Reign Supreme

Princess Elizabeth Alexandra Mary was born on April 21, 1926, the first child of the Duke and Duchess of York, subsequently King George VI and Queen Elizabeth. At age eleven, Elizabeth's father became King when her uncle Edward abdicated, and she became second in line to the throne. Her engagement to Prince Philip of Greece marked the dawn of a new era after WWII. The nation rejoiced at Elizabeth and Philip's wedding and one year later at the birth of Prince Charles. Two years later, Princess Anne was born. On route to Australia for a royal visit in 1952, she was informed that her father had passed away. Elizabeth immediately returned home and was crowned Queen Elizabeth II on June 2, 1953. With the births of Prince Andrew and Prince Edward in the 1960s, the royal family was complete. This retrospective biography honors Elizabeth II, the United Kingdom's most-beloved Queen for 70 years.
